Transaction e80aa2631a668ffe1b12a8945a57ddd5df09334611f95db0b145a0a2afb26a35
1 Input
1 Output
-
e80aa2631a668ffe1b12a8945a57ddd5df09334611f95db0b145a0a2afb26a35:0
- value
- 34218
- script pubkey
- OP_0 OP_PUSHBYTES_20 5589d660e7853ca9539865fc0864e1d5294ddaa9
- address
- bc1q2kyavc88s572j5ucvh7qse8p6555mk4fqr6a0t